The Landscape of Spinal Surgery & Implant Procurement in Greece

Greece's healthcare landscape is undergoing an accelerated modernization phase. The Hellenic National Health System (ESY), alongside major private healthcare networks in metropolitan hubs like Athens, Thessaloniki, and Patras, demands high-quality, EU MDR-compliant orthopedic and spinal implants. Under pressure from health insurance organizations like EOPYY, Greek medical procurers seek cost-effective, high-tier implants that minimize patient hospitalization times while maintaining maximum surgical efficacy.

The prevalence of degenerative spinal pathologies, trauma cases from regional transportation networks, and a rapidly aging Mediterranean demographic have elevated the local demand for posterior lumbar fixation devices, cervical plates, and minimally invasive (MIS) surgical kits. Local orthopedic distributors and hospital suppliers require reliable manufacturing partners that can provide both standardized inventory and highly specialized custom solutions.

Biomechanical Design & Engineering Benchmarks

Our spinal implants are synthesized using medical-grade Titanium Alloy (Ti-6Al-4V ELI) conforming to ASTM F136 standards. The design profile optimizes load-sharing mechanisms, mitigates stress shielding, and facilitates rapid osseointegration.

Implant Component Material Specification Surface Treatment Clinical Intent & Application
Polyaxial Pedicle Screws Ti-6Al-4V ELI (ASTM F136) Anodized Oxide Coating Severe spondylolisthesis, degenerative disc disease, and mechanical instability.
Minimally Invasive (MIS) Screws Titanium Alloy Grade 5 Ultra-smooth polished thread Percutaneous spinal stabilization with minimal soft tissue disruption.
Cervical Fixation Screws Biocompatible Titanium Acid-etched micro-texture Anterior/posterior cervical decompression and fusion stabilization.
Titanium Connection Rods Grade 5 Hard Titanium / CoCr Polished satin finish Deformity correction, trauma stabilization, and rigid structural bridging.

Technical Roadmap & Future Outlook (2025-2030)

The field of spine arthrodesis and stabilization is transitioning toward smart implants, customized patient geometries, and navigation-guided surgical workflows. Moventra is actively aligning its R&D with these upcoming paradigms to ensure our Greek distribution partners remain ahead of the market curve.

Our upcoming product generation includes porous 3D-printed titanium structures that mimic trabecular bone geometry, promoting enhanced biological fixation and early vascularization. We are also optimizing implant surfaces with biomimetic coatings to lower infection risks, which is a major concern in crowded intensive care settings globally.

Innovations in Development:

  • Smart Instrumented Screws: Micro-sensors engineered to track real-time spinal load changes and bone fusion progress post-surgery.
  • Biocompatible PEEK Alternatives: Hybrid titanium-PEEK cages combining surface osteoconductivity with optimal radiolucency.
  • Navigational Tool Integration: Enhanced tool geometry designed to integrate with navigation systems from leading global brands.
  • Ultra-Low Profile Cervical Plates: Minimizing postoperative dysphagia through thin structural design profiles.

1. How do you support registration with the Greek National Organization for Medicines (EOF)?
We provide a complete technical file containing biocompatibility certificates, mechanical testing summaries (ASTM F1717 / ASTM F1798), and MDR-compliant product declarations. This enables your local regulatory team to file registrations smoothly with EOF.
2. Can you customize spine systems for private labels (OEM/ODM) in Greece?
Yes. Backed by our R&D team of 86 engineers, we offer full design engineering, rapid prototyping, and private labeling services. We can customize screw head geometry, thread pitch, and connection rods based on your specific requirements.
3. What raw materials do you source for spinal implants?
We strictly utilize premium medical-grade Titanium Alloy (Ti-6Al-4V ELI) conforming to ASTM F136 specifications. This ensures high fatigue strength, excellent biocompatibility, and optimal osseointegration.
4. What is the typical lead time for delivery to Greek ports or airports?
For standard inventory orders, shipment can be dispatched within 7–14 business days. For customized OEM runs, production takes 30–45 days. We coordinate directly with air freight networks to Athens (ATH) and sea freight channels to Piraeus.
5. Are your implants packaged in sterile cleanroom conditions?
Yes, our packaging environment complies with cleanroom standards (Class 100,000 / ISO Class 7). Implants can be delivered sterile (Gamma or EO irradiated) or non-sterile for local sterilization processes, depending on your preferences.
